Female health not removing from tracker

Replies are disabled for this topic. Start a new one or visit our Help Center.

anyone elSe found female health appearing on watch (even though you’ve deleted all data) after inputting wealth and/or water? So frustrating . Nb already tried resetting, factory reset, removing, all that stuff. Wasted literally hours and  hours on Fitbit helpline then chat today! And got nowhere 😞

It's great to see you around @JanieD. Thanks for the details mentioned and the time you spent troubleshooting it with our Support team. 

It's pretty weird that you're seeing Female Health on your Fitbit Inspire HR. In this case, I would like you to remove your tracker from the account and set it up as a replacement device. This should remove it from your tracker.

Done all this - again. It’s still showing water, weight and female health on my watch! I’m beyond frustrated. None of this showed on my watch until I imputted water and weight data on Friday. Which I have since cleared all record of. Yet it is still loading water 0 and my actual weight and  a default menstrual cycle day on my watch! Having searched forums it seems there is no option to remove this from my tracker nor the weight nor water. It was possible to do this with my Alta but not my inspire. People seem to have been complaining about this since May But nothing has been done. Am I right in thinking that this is the case? Nb I have even changed myself to a man on the phone and it still doesn’t solve it and then I read posts from men saying they looked at the female health data with their daughter or whatever out of curiosity and then deleted the tile and now they cannot get rid of it from their tracker either!!!
